Comfort Keepers II in Baxter, MN is a welcoming and fully furnished assisted living community that provides a comfortable and caring environment for seniors. Residents can enjoy a range of amenities, including cable or satellite TV, a dining room for communal meals, and access to outdoor spaces such as gardens. The community also offers housekeeping services to ensure a clean and tidy living space.
For added convenience, there is a kitchenette available for residents who wish to prepare their own snacks or light meals. Move-in coordination is provided to assist with the transition into the community.
Meals at Comfort Keepers II are served restaurant-style in the dining room, with special dietary restrictions taken into consideration. A small library is available for residents to relax and enjoy reading.
The community places great emphasis on providing excellent care services. There is 24-hour supervision to ensure safety and assistance with activities of daily living as needed. Trained staff members are available to provide assistance with bathing, dressing, and transfers. Medication management services are also offered to help residents stay on track with their medications.
Comfort Keepers II offers a mental wellness program to support the emotional well-being of residents. In addition, diabetes diets and special dietary restrictions can be accommodated.
Residents have the opportunity to participate in resident-run activities as well as scheduled daily activities organized by the caring staff members. This provides social engagement and opportunities for personal growth.

The deductibility of assisted living expenses on taxes hinges on factors like the individual's medical condition and service nature, typically requiring the resident to be "chronically ill" per IRS definitions. Taxpayers may deduct eligible medical expenses related to personal care services but generally not rent unless primarily for medical care, and they should maintain thorough documentation to support claims while considering itemizing versus standard deductions.
